85-Year-Old Inspires Generations of Runners

On his 85th birthday, Eric Hughes of Bridgend proved age is just a number as he raced alongside his great-grandson at a Parkrun event, an experience he described as unforgettable. “I planned to walk, but when I got there with my great-grandson, I decided to run”.

A lifelong runner and medalist in 18 British Masters Championships, Eric has been a passionate volunteer at over 500 Parkruns, helping to organize events that now see hundreds of participants. He believes these community runs are cultivating the next generation of athletes.

Eric is particularly inspired by seeing children, some as young as four, develop their natural talent through Parkrun. “They might start running with their parents, but soon they insist on running on their own,” he shared.

The director of Porthcawl Parkrun praised Eric as a role model and vital part of the volunteer community. Eric’s competitive spirit remains strong, as shown on his birthday, when he celebrated not only his own passion for running but the joy of passing it down to future generations.
